Subject: [PATCH v7 00/18] Tegra124 EMC (external memory controller) support
Date: Wed, 11 Mar 2015 11:34:13 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1426070126-26910-1-git-send-email-tomeu.vizoso@collabora.com> (raw)
Hello,
this v7 rebases on top of v4.0-rc1 and contains the following changes:
* Removes registers from the burst blocks that were redundant
* Removes nvidia,emc-cfg-dig-dll as it is unused in T124
* Adds timings for the Nyan Big and Blaze boards
* Disables the ARBITRATION_EMEM interrupt, as it can be very disruptive when
the EMC clock runs at low frequencies and shouldn't probably be enabled in
any case in a production kernel as it's intended to be used as a development
tool
* I have tested it on the Nyan boards, in addition to the Jetson TK1
Patch 1: Removes the old EMC clock, that was unused and not functional
Patch 2: Documents bindings for the new long-ram-code property
Patch 3: Adds API for reading the ram code
Patches 4 to 7: Document OF additions
Patch 8: Adds EMC node to Tegra124 DT
Patch 9: Adds timings for Jetson TK1 board
Patch 10: Adds functions to the MC driver so the EMC driver can stay within
its own registers
Patch 11: Adds the actual EMC driver, making use of the new MC API
Patch 12: Exposes clk_hw_reparent function
Patch 13: Adds EMC clock driver, making use of API provided by the EMC driver
Patch 14: Adds debugfs entry for getting and setting the EMC rate
Patch 15: On Tegra124, have the EMC clock be the parent of the MC clock
Patches 16 and 17: Add timings for the Nyan Big and Blaze boards
Patches 18: Disables ARBITRATION_EMEM
